#14 re: McCain Benedict Arnold was a POW from the failed early Canadian campaign. Exchanged, he went on to lead the critical combat that lead to the victory at Saratoga. However, he never felt he got the recognition and rewards for his service, so, as well all know, his ego let him to betray his fellow Americans. |
